Bun in the Oven: The Real Guide to Pregnancy

Most pregnancy books are straightforward, humorless, and full of broad generalizations. Yet, there's something downright hilarious about uncontrollable gas, crazy food cravings, and your body generally becoming a host organ. At last here's a pregnancy guide about what to expect when you're an expectant, modern, career woman with a sense of humor. Australia's best-selling A BUN IN THE OVEN delivers the up-to-date lowdown on pregnancy, birth, and coping with your newborn when you first get home. No bossy rules, just lots of cartoons and the soundest, sanest, wittiest advice you'll ever get. Week by week, author and cartoonist Kaz Cooke tells you what's happening to you and the baby and tackles subjects such as how to prepare for pregnancy, choosing a doctor, undergoing tests, childbirth, pain relief, and breastfeeding. Everything you need to know about the scary parts, the funny parts, and your private parts.
Book Info
Humorous consumer text delivers the up-to-date lowdown on pregnancy, birth, and coping. Provides witty, sound advice and illustrated with cartoons. Covers fetus development on a week-by-week basis, childbirth classes, maternity and baby clothes, travel and safety, baby names, breastfeeding, what to expect at the hospital, and more. Softcover.
